He will talk to the students 25X1A at the-as much as possible. 3, DDS Staff Meeting. a. Proposals to Employ People after Retirement. We should be very clear about the absolute need for employing Agency officers after retirement. We should give extremely serious consideration to this matter; we should not be doing it for humanitarian reasons. Contribution of such persons should be definite and certainly not a convenience to the individual. In other words, he must have some particular skill that clearly meets the need. b. Language Development Committee. reported the follow- ing Directorate's representatives on the Language Committee: DDS&T; DDP. The DDI representative has not yet been named. The DDTR, as chairman of the Committee, plans to have a meeting this week. Mr. Richardson said a good agenda item for the first meeting would be clarification of the sentence in the CIA Foreign Language Training Program that a CT has to have an "Elementary" knowledge of a foreign language before he is assigned to his career service. Mr. Richardson assumes this does not necessarily mean that he stays with us and meets the requirement before he is assigned to a job. The DTR wonders if every officer going to the DDI would have to have an "Elementary" proficiency. 1A 6-:overage in SOC.
